#0024d0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0024d0 is composed of 0% red, 14.1%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 100% cyan, 82.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 229.6 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 40.8%. #0024d0 color hex could be obtained by blending #0048ff with #0000a1. Closest websafe color is: #0033cc.

Shades and Tints of #0024d0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00020c is the darkest color, while #f7f9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0024d0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#606370 is the less saturated color, while #0024d0 is the most saturated one.
